What factors would affect the MDI performance?

A. Ambient temperature
B. Propellant pressure
C. Valve design
D. All of the above

Answer :

Final answer:

Ambient temperature, propellant pressure, and valve design are all factors that can affect the performance of a Metered Dose Inhaler (MDI). Thus, the correct answer is option D) All of the above.

Explanation:

Factors that could affect the performance of a Metered Dose Inhaler (MDI) include ambient temperature, propellant pressure, and valve design. Ambient temperature can influence the vapor pressure of the propellant and thus affect the MDI output. Propellant pressure is critical as it drives the medication out of the inhaler, and variations in pressure can alter the dose delivered. The valve design is also significant since it controls the timing and size of the medication particles, which are crucial for optimal deposition in the lungs.
